GNCMA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

140 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in GCI Liberty, Inc. Class A-1 Common Stock (GNCMA)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$863M — up 75% from $493M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 41 funds opened new GNCMA positions and 22 closed out — a net gain of 19 holders — while 31 added to existing stakes and 52 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Magnetar Financial, opening a new position worth an estimated $33.6M. The largest seller was Invesco, cutting an estimated $45.2M.
